Become a Web Developer (HTML5;CSS;JavaScript;Ruby;Ajax; SQL)

Why take this course?
π Become a Web Developer (HTML5, CSS, JavaScript, Ruby, Ajax, SQL) π
Hello & Welcome to Your Web Development Journey!
If you're stepping into the world of web development for the first time, this course is designed to help you build a strong foundation. Whether you're a student eager to learn, a teacher seeking comprehensive materials, a hobbyist with a passion for coding, or simply curious about how web technologies function, this course will guide you through each concept step by step.
Course Objective
The goal of this course is to take you from a beginner to a comfortably skilled individual who can confidently explore and experiment with web development further. We're here to turn the complex into the comprehensible, ensuring you have a solid understanding of each topic.
Core Technologies: The Pillars of Web Development
- πΉ HTML: The backbone for structuring web pages and creating content.
- πΈ CSS: Essential for styling your HTML and presenting it in a visually appealing manner.
- πΉ JavaScript: Adds interactivity to your web pages, making them dynamic and user-friendly.
Together, these three technologies form the basis of front-end web development, which is the first step before diving into back-end functionalities.
Topics Covered in This Course
We'll dive into a variety of topics that will give you a hands-on experience with each aspect of web development. Here's a sneak peek at what you'll learn:
- HTML Document Structure
- Anatomy of an HTML Element
- Marking up Text and Creating Links
- Basics of Comments & HTML Attributes
- Introduction to CSS (Cascading Style Sheets)
- Ways to Apply CSS and Understanding the CSS Ruleset
- Styling with Selectors, Box Model, Margin, Padding, Background Color, Display Properties, Fonts & More!
- The Fundamentals of JavaScript
- Data Types, Operators, Conditional Statements, Functions, and Much More!
Ruby: The Powerful Programming Language
Ruby is a modern, object-oriented language, and Ruby on Rails is an elegant framework for building robust web applications. This course will not only teach you the basics of Ruby but also show you how to build a complete blog application using Ruby on Rails. π
Building a Blog Application with Rails
In this hands-on project, you'll cover essential concepts such as:
- Creating a New Rails Project
- Using Bundler to Manage Gems
- Understanding the Model-View-Controller (MVC) Architecture
- Setting Up and Running the Rails Server
- Implementing Conditional Statements, Loops & Controllers in Rails
- Associating Models and Building Views
- Generating Models, Running Migrations, and Managing Data
- Creating Forms and User Interactions
- Enhancing Security Measures
By the end of this course, you'll have a comprehensive understanding of web development, with the skills necessary to be creative and expand upon your projects or build entirely new applications from scratch. π οΈπ
Embark on your journey to becoming a web developer today! With practical hands-on experience, engaging content, and expert guidance, you'll be building and deploying your own projects in no time.
Loading charts...